1. Copywriter

There is a variety of income-generating work-at-home jobs for writers. Copywriting is one of the most accessible avenues for those interested in freelancing. You don’t need a specialized degree to get started, and you don’t need to invest in expensive equipment. In addition, it is a lucrative field with many opportunities.

Content is king these days. Companies must produce content to expand their online presence, attract customers and make sales. Many organizations have huge content production budgets to meet their needs and turn to copywriters to do all the work. Copywriters can work in different departments. Many focus their efforts on content marketing, emails, and blog articles.

You will accept work from many clients as a freelance copywriter before establishing a niche. Some of the most successful copywriters have carved out a niche in which they can excel. For example, some focus on medical copywriting. Some freelance jobs can also turn into casual marketing or ghostwriting positions. There is room for growth, and this job offers enough variety for anyone to find their project.

2. Types of work at home with income in the field of filming

There is a variety of income-generating work-at-home jobs in the field of videography. Videographers spend their time producing video content for a wide range of clients. As with copywriting, there is room to hone skills and focus on a specific type of work. Many videographers have a background in content production. For example, many start as filmmakers or social media creators. The key is to develop skills like video compositing, storytelling, and editing.

As a videographer, your job is to produce video content for clients. Contrary to popular belief, videos on social media and e-commerce sites are usually not the work of an in-house team. Many organizations hire third-party freelancers to record videos.

4. Types of work at home with income in the field of translation

There are various income working-at-home jobs with translation titles. Companies large and small need to serve English-only countries. This is where translators come in. With this freelance job, you’ll work on making everything from marketing materials to product descriptions available in other languages. Since businesses have a wealth of content, there is a lot of work to be done.

Being a translator requires more than proficiency in another language. Many freelancers have academic work or relevant work experience in a specific field. Language requires understanding the nuances of a distinct language and the industry’s intricacies.

5. SEO

There is a variety of income-generating work-at-home SEO jobs on the Internet. SEO stands for Search Engine Optimization, and any company can use it. SEO aims to fine-tune websites to rank as high as possible on search engine results pages. Every brand wants to be the first thing people see when they search for something relevant. So many are willing to pay a lot to work with an SEO expert.

6. Web designer

Having high-quality content is vital for businesses. You can imagine how important a website design can be. Web designers are responsible for creating well-designed websites that extend a brand’s online presence. It’s not just about making something that looks good. It should perform well and provide a great user experience.

There is a variety of income-generating work-at-home jobs for web designers. There is a lot of confusion about the difference between developers and designers. A web designer focuses on the aesthetics and experience of visiting a site. Contrary to popular belief, they don’t need to know a lot of coding or be proficient in a particular programming language.
